Step 1
Preheat the oven to 170°C
Step 2
Cut off one end the yam and cut into big chunks.
Step 3
Peel the yam and cut into sticks/batons. Drop the yam into a bowl of water to prevent browning.
Step 4
Pour the yam sticks into a colander to drain, then pour in a bowl.
Step 5
Melt the butter so it turns liquid. Pour into the bowl with some salt and the spices.
Step 6
Toss the yam to get even coating on all pieces and pour on a baking tray.
Step 7
Make sure the oven has achieved the right temperature, and place the tray in.
Step 8
Leave to bake for 20 mins. Remove from the oven and serve hot.
